Candice Eberhardt has been helping people buy and sell homes in the Akron area for more than 25 years. She got her real estate license in 2001 when she was just 20 years old, making her one of the youngest agents in her market at the time. A decade later, she earned a degree in real estate and passed her broker exam in 2012. That same year, on October 31, she opened Eberhardt Realty, which she still runs today.
Her agency, based in the Wallhaven neighborhood of Northwest Akron, was recently named the number one real estate agency in that area by Business Rate for 2026. For Candice, the recognition reflects years of steady work and a commitment to serving clients who are often overlooked by larger firms.
Serving First-Time Homebuyers
Most of her clients are first-time homebuyers. Many come to her facing challenges with credit or struggling to pull together the funds needed to close on a house. Instead of turning them away, Candice meets with them personally and connects them to agencies that can help them prepare financially. Some of these programs even offer grant money to assist with the purchase.
She stays in touch throughout the entire process, sometimes for months, until they are ready to buy. Then she helps them find the right home.
